Meet Milo, a 4-year-old bundle of calm and gentle energy, weighing in at a just15 lbs. Milo's an independent pup who's perfectly content being on his own, yet he loves affection when it comes his way.

Milo is crate trained and housebroken, making him a breeze to have around the house. He's quiet in his kennel, and on walks, he's a well-behaved gentleman. He is not overly needy, but he's definitely affectionate when he's in the mood.

When it comes to other animals, Milo is a cool cucumber. He's neutral around dogs, cats, and even chickens! He knows his basic commands like sit, kennel, come, and speak, showing off his smarts and well-mannered nature.

Milo is looking for a home where he can be his independent self, while still enjoying cuddles and playtime. If you're looking for a calm, low-maintenance companion who will quietly fit into your life, Milo could be the perfect match for you!

The mission of The Happy Pet Project is to partner with local municipal shelters to end the overpopulation of companion animals in Texas through rescue, rehabilitation and adoption, while educating people about responsible pet ownership, animal advocacy, and topics related to animal welfare.
